use std::fmt;
use reqwest::StatusCode;
use serde::Deserialize;
#[derive(Debug, Deserialize)]
#[serde(rename_all = "camelCase")]
pub struct ApiError {
error_code: String,
details: String,
}
impl std::error::Error for ApiError {}
impl fmt::Display for ApiError {
fn fmt(&self, f: &mut fmt::Formatter<'_>) -> fmt::Result {
write!(f, "(errorCode: {}, details: {})", self.error_code, self.details)
}
}
pub type Result<T, E = Error> = std::result::Result<T, E>;
#[derive(Debug, thiserror::Error)]
pub enum Error {
#[error("request error: {0}")]
Request(String),
#[error("status code {0}: {1}")]
StatusCode(u16, String),
#[error("exceeded request limit")]
RateLimited(Option<usize>),
#[error("bad request")]
BadRequest,
#[error("request unauthorized")]
Unauthorized,
#[error("api error: {0}")]
Api(#[from] ApiError),
#[error("json parse error: {0}")]
ParseJson(#[from] serde_json::Error),
#[error("url parse error: {0}")]
ParseUrl(#[from] url::ParseError),
#[error("input/output error: {0}")]
IO(#[from] std::io::Error),
#[error("Read error")]
ReadError { source: std::io::Error },
#[error("Parsing PKCS12 error")]
Pkcs12Error { source: reqwest::Error },
#[error("Parsing Certificate error")]
CertificateError { source: reqwest::Error },
#[error("Parsing PEM error")]
PemError { source: pem::PemError },
}
impl Error {
#[cfg(feature = "__async")]
pub async fn from_response(response: reqwest::Response) -> Self {
match response.status() {
status @ StatusCode::UNAUTHORIZED
| status @ StatusCode::BAD_REQUEST
| status @ StatusCode::PAYMENT_REQUIRED
| status @ StatusCode::FORBIDDEN => response
.json::<ApiError>()
.await
.map(Into::into)
.unwrap_or_else(|_| status.into()),
status => status.into(),
}
}
#[cfg(feature = "__sync")]
pub fn from_response(response: reqwest::blocking::Response) -> Self {
match response.status() {
status @ StatusCode::UNAUTHORIZED
| status @ StatusCode::BAD_REQUEST
| status @ StatusCode::PAYMENT_REQUIRED
| status @ StatusCode::FORBIDDEN => response
.json::<ApiError>()
.map(Into::into)
.unwrap_or_else(|_| status.into()),
status => status.into(),
}
}
}
impl From<reqwest::Error> for Error {
fn from(err: reqwest::Error) -> Self {
Self::Request(err.to_string())
}
}
impl From<reqwest::StatusCode> for Error {
fn from(code: reqwest::StatusCode) -> Self {
Self::StatusCode(code.as_u16(), code.canonical_reason().unwrap_or("unknown").to_string())
}
}
